Default Please report potholes

I mean it - I did, to Shropshire Council. The road up to Ellesmere is an absolute disgrace, and the worst bit is by the ABP abattoir at Hordley as they have so many HGV deliveries. Turns out that ABP have a planning application in to expand the plant, so things are on hold. Email from the Council as follows:

Ed Your email dated 14/01 [I think it was 7.1!!! - Ed] has been forwarded for my attention .I agree that the road needs overlaying and we are currently on site trying to make it safe .I have a scheme prepared to overlay but it is on hold until the current planning application has been resolved sorry Steve
